M40 Combat Helmet |
|
|
|
|
|
 |
|
|
|
|
|
 |
|
|
|
|
|
|
The M40 helmet was one of the several styles of helmet to serve in WWII. By 1942, it was by far the most common and by the end of the war it was THE helmet of the Red army. It should have a three pad liner and a web chinstrap. |

Equipment Belt |
|
|
|
|
|
 |
|
|
|
|
|
Several variations of equipment belts were used in The Great Patriotic War. By the middle of the war, the web belt with leather reinforcement was very common. |

Mosin Nagant Ammo Pouch |
|
|
|
|
|
 |
|
|
|
|
|
If you carry a Mosin Nagant rifle or carbine you need to carry one ammo pouch. We would prefer everyone to have an early war pouch (pictured left) for 1943 events and a late war pouch (pictured right) for 44 and 45. |

Gasmask Bag |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
Every Russian soldier was issued a gasmask. Some people say that they threw them out, but we have determined through careful examination of photos and common sense that many soldiers retained their gas masks and this is what they carried them in. |
